About the role

The Modern Work business unit, which includes the commercial segments of Office and Windows, has undergone fundamental changes as we have shifted our business from perpetual software and transactional sales to cloud services and subscription licensing. Secular trends accelerated by the global pandemic, including hybrid and remote work, have reinforced customer demand for our products and have fueled phenomenal business growth. To sustain our rapid growth, we continually explore new business models, transform our Go To Market (GTM) and invest in new product categories that expand our total addressable market.

 

More than financial analysts, we in Modern Work Finance are grounded in data on current business performance, adept in framing and communicating complex business issues, skilled in quantitative analysis, and passionate about driving the business forward. In addition to the many exciting opportunities, we generate positive business impact and the demands that places on our time, we also find room in our schedules to unwind and socialize as a team, activities which are integral to creating an inclusive and connected team environment, vital to our long-term career growth.

 

Within Modern Work Finance, the Business Planning Finance team provides insightful and rigorous analyses, both quantitative and qualitative, to support pricing, packaging, licensing, strategic partership and business development deals, new product and datacenter investments, and other long-term decisions for Microsoft 365 and related products, across all commercial segments (Enterprise, frontline workers (FLW), small and medium business (SMB), EDU, PubSec/Gov Cloud). We provide thought leadership by creating, evolving, and socializing business analysis frameworks such as Customer Lifetime Value, the Long-Range Plan & Growth Framework, and many others to bring clarity to complex business issues and help inform decisions by our leaders.

 

This Senior Finance Manager - Modern Work Business Planning Finance position will focus on driving long-range planning, financial analysis, modeling, and inorganic investment analyses for our FLW segment, and own the all-up long-range planning (LRP) consolidation for the Modern Work CSA. This role will involve business partners across Business Planning, Product Marketing, Business and Corporate Development, Engineering and other Finance teams. As such, you will play a significant role in driving business growth for Modern Workplace and Microsoft, and in particular drive revenue expansion strategies and business model evolution for our on-prem and M365 portfolio in the FLW segment. Responsibilities

  • Pricing & packaging: Partner with Business Planning Marketing to determine the optimal pricing and packaging of new products or features, either as a separate standalone offer or as part of a suite
  • Long-range planning: Lead the development of three- to five-year revenue plans for offers targeting the FLW customer segment, including evaluating risks and opportunities. Drive all-up Modern Work LRP consolidation.
  • Inorganic investments: Conduct ad-hoc analyses and frame business cases for strategic partnerships and investments
  • Market & addressable opportunity: Research, define and quantify the addressable market for current and future products, including assessing current market share and identifying opportunities for growth
